Fiber optic connectors are vital in modern communication systems, providing the interface for transmitting data through optical fibers. These connectors are designed to ensure precise alignment and high-performance data transfer. To address heat management, fiber optic connectors often include heatsinks. These heatsinks, typically crafted from materials with high thermal conductivity, help dissipate heat and maintain the connector's efficiency and longevity. Shielding is another critical feature of fiber optic connectors. Shielding, achieved through the use of conductive materials, protects the connectors from electromagnetic interference (EMI). This prevents signal distortion and ensures that data transmission remains clear and reliable, even in environments with high levels of electronic noise. The connector's design is also key to ensuring a stable and secure connection between fibers, ensuring high-quality performance across various applications.
